2. Data Architecture
Step 1: The Edge (Local Processing)
Your Apple Watch acts as the primary compute node.
- Raw Telemetry: 100Hz Accelerometer data and Raw R-R Intervals are processed locally on the device using CoreMotion and Accelerate frameworks.
- Feature Extraction: We calculate DFA Alpha-1 (Metabolic Thresholds) and Asymmetry (Gait Mechanics) on-chip.
- Sanitization: Data is stripped of PII (Personally Identifiable Information) before it leaves the device. User IDs are hashed using SHA-256.
Step 2: The Bridge (Secure Ingestion)
If you opt-in to the Distributed Research protocol:
- Transport: Data is transmitted via Mutual TLS (mTLS) to verify authenticity.
- Storage: Anonymized time-series data is stored in Google BigQuery for the sole purpose of training our Global Human Gait Genome model.
3. Local Mesh Networking
Our "Squad Sync" feature uses Apple Multipeer Connectivity. This creates a local, serverless mesh network between runners. Position and telemetry data are exchanged directly between devices via Wi-Fi Direct and Bluetooth LE. This data never touches the internet.
